Chinese Prepare Restaurant Style Chilli Garlic Noodles At Home

Spice up your meals with bold and flavourful Chili Garlic Noodles, a quick and easy Indo-Chinese dish packed with vibrant flavours and the perfect kick of heat.

For someone who wants to indulge in bold and spicy noodle soup packed with all its spiciness, Chilli Garlic Noodles is one such comfort food item that hits your taste. Vibrant red in colour and full of strong flavours, it combines the deep aroma of garlic, the burning sensation of chilli sauce, and the crunch of stir-fried vegetables tossed in perfectly cooked noodles. This is another versatile recipe that can be enjoyed as a single dish or with any hot curry. It is quick to make at home in under 30 minutes.


Ready to recreate this restaurant-style favourite? Try these easy steps to make perfect Chilli Garlic Noodles at home!

Ingredients

  • 300 Gram Hakka Noodles
  • 2 Tablespoon Sesame Oil
  • Garlic
  • 1 Piece Onion
  • 1 Piece Green Chili
  • 1 Piece Carrot
  • 1 Cup Cabbage
  • 0.5 Piece Yellow Bell Pepper
  • 0.5 Piece Red Bell Pepper
  • 0.5 Piece Green Capsicum
  • Spring Onion Whites
  • 2 Tablespoon Vinegar
  • 2 Tablespoon Soy Sauce
  • 1 Tablespoon Red Chili Sauce
  • 1 Tablespoon Green Chili Sauce
  • 1 Teaspoon Pepper
  • Spring Onion Greens
  • Water
  • Salt To Taste

Cooking Instructions

Step 1

Bring a pot of water to a boil, add a pinch of salt, and cook the hakka noodles until 90%done.

Step 2

Drain the noodles and toss them with a little oil to prevent sticking. Set them aside.

Step 3

Heat sesame oil in a pan and saute finely chopped garlic, onion, and green chilli until aromatic.

Step 4

Add vegetable such as carrots, shredded cabbage, and diced yellow, red, and green bell peppers, along with spring onion whites.

Step 5

Stir in vinegar, soy sauce, red chilli sauce, green chilli sauce, and a sprinkle of pepper powder.

Step 6

Add the cooked noodles to the pan and toss everything well. Stir fry for about 10 minutes until well combined.

Step 7

Taste the noodles and adjust the salt as needed.

Step 8

Garnish with freshly chopped spring onion greens.

Step 9

Serve the hot and flavourful chilli garlic noodles.
